Angel Model from ~b-e-c-k-y-stock at DA Fairy Tale Based on The Angel by Hans Christian Andersen Plot summary A child has died, and an angel is escorting him to Heaven. They wander over the earth for a while, visiting the child’s favorite places. Along the way they gather flowers to transplant into the gardens of Heaven. The angel takes the child to a poverty-stricken area where a dead field lily lies in a trash heap. The angel salvages the flower explaining that it had cheered a crippled boy before he died. The angel then reveals he was the boy. Nov 08

This is my little angel statue which survived massive trees falling all around it during Hurricane Gustav. After the storm, when the tree surgeons came to remove the debris that was everywhere, I forgot to tell them that a little angel was under three of the many splintered trees in my yard and that the angel should be moved to safety before they downed the broken oaks. As the giants came crashing to the ground, I remembered and cringed. Now, she’s crushed, I knew. But I was wrong. After the piles of wood were moved away, there was the statue, still intact! It had made it through two calamities! Today, it is a symbol to me of survival, a symbol that miracles do happen. May miracles abound this Christmas and in the New Year. Blessings to all!
